The adoption fees are $100 for dogs and $135 for dogs 6 months and younger. The $85 fee for cats 6 months and older is currently being waived and for kittens has been reduced to $50. The fee includes spay/neuter surgery, preliminary vaccinations, microchip and registration, heartworm test for dogs and feline leukemia test for cats and more. The adoption fee for rabbits is $20.00.
